A study of CMAC neural network generalized predictive control for generating unit

摘要

Large thermal power unit is complex, nonlinear, big lag system. Using the traditional control method is difficult to get the best running effect. And in neural network modeling based on multivariable generalized predictive control strategy, has wide range, strong robustness etc, and can effectively make up for the deficiency. Based on the Cerebellar Model Articulation Controller neural network modeling, after the online rolling optimization and feedback correction, realize the predictive control. The simulation results show its validity.
